Education

I’m a professional member of the National Association of Nutrition Professionals (NANP), and I hold an Honorary Board Certification in Holistic Nutrition. 

I graduated with a BA in Journalism & Fine Arts from Indiana University, after which I maintained a successful graphic design career for 15 years. In 2000, I followed my passion for health to the Seven Bowls School of Nutrition, Nourishment and Healing, a 3-year, master’s level program in nutrition, herbalism, and complimentary medicine where I graduated with a certification of Integrated Clinical Nutrition Therapist.

My Story

Because I was diagnosed with food sensitivities in 1986, I’ve been challenged to eat gluten-, dairy- and corn-free for over 30 years. Believe me when I say that I can help you eat delicious food, despite having to avoid one or many foods, due to sensitivities, intolerances or allergies. I love to cook delicious meals and create recipes from food grown in my organic garden, and I also know all the tricks to eat healthfully despite those challenging circumstances we all face: travel, long meetings, car trips, camping, playground, and even lunchtime.

Because each of us is an individual with our own biochemical make-up, my recommendations, meal plans, cleanse programs, and recipes, are designed to meet the specific needs of you and your family. In order to help you regain balance, strength and vitality I may also make recommendations that rely upon my knowledge of herbs and supplemental nutrients.
